Use my fork of the Wiring-Pi Python library which checks out the WiringOP fork of the WiringPi library as a submodule to build everything. yes that's a little confusing
The WiringPI library is the original C library that RaspGPIO is somewhat based on. WiringPi was built to replicate arduino GPIO functions
In Raspberry Pi Land there are 2 normal python paths for GPIO. One is Raspi.GPIO and the other is WiringPI

#!/bin/bash | |
# Example - to set the logs retention policy for your default AWS account in region eu-west-1 to 5 days, execute the command: | |
# set-retention.sh default eu-west-1 5 | |
export AWS_PROFILE=$1 | |
export AWS_REGION=$2 | |
RETENTION_DAYS=${3:-30} | |
echo "AWS_PROFILE=$AWS_PROFILE, AWS_REGION=$AWS_REGION, RETENTION_DAYS=$RETENTION_DAYS" | |
while read -r i; | |
do (aws logs put-retention-policy --region "$AWS_REGION" --log-group-name "$i" --retention-in-days "$RETENTION_DAYS" ); | |
done < <(aws logs describe-log-groups --region "$AWS_REGION" --query 'logGroups[*].[logGroupName]' | grep / | sed 's/"//g') |
